Transaction 593f7eb07cb177142a51399eeb067454863d0385778816b4db121bff99f44601
1 Input
2 Outputs
- 593f7eb07cb177142a51399eeb067454863d0385778816b4db121bff99f44601:0
- 593f7eb07cb177142a51399eeb067454863d0385778816b4db121bff99f44601:1
value 566757
address 1CwuhLy7Jw5ZtRiBJGEqQtmVqMyHthEuUg
value 98467704
address 1L7LgyYsweBC8zWPRFoFfNTpL7biH3xTsB